Disability shower installation services involve the modification or creation of shower spaces to accommodate individuals with mobility challenges or disabilities. These services typically include installing accessible features such as low-threshold or curbless showers, grab bars, non-slip flooring, and seating options. The goal is to create a safe and functional bathing environment that minimizes the risk of falls and makes daily routines easier for users with limited mobility or other physical needs.

These installations address common problems faced by individuals with disabilities or aging-related mobility issues, such as difficulty stepping over high thresholds, instability in traditional shower setups, and the lack of supportive features. By upgrading existing showers or designing new accessible units, these services help improve safety, independence, and comfort during bathing activities. They can also reduce the need for assistance, promoting greater autonomy for users while easing the burden on caregivers.

Installation Costs - The cost for installing a disability shower typically ranges from $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the shower size and features. Basic models tend to be on the lower end, while custom or accessible designs increase the price.

Material Expenses - Material costs for disability shower installations can vary from $500 to $2,500. Options like slip-resistant flooring, grab bars, and waterproof panels influence the overall expense.

Labor Charges - Labor fees for installing a disability shower often fall between $800 and $2,500. The complexity of the installation and local labor rates impact the total labor cost.

Additional Features - Adding features such as seating, handheld showerheads, or specialized controls can add $300 to $1,200 to the overall cost. These enhancements are chosen based on individual accessibility need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ing a disability shower? Installing a disability shower can improve safety and accessibility for individuals with mobility challenges, making daily routines easier and reducing fall risks.

How do I find local professionals for disability shower installation? To find qualified local pros, contact service providers specializing in accessible bathroom modifications in the Buffalo, MN area.

What types of disability showers are available? There are various options including walk-in showers, low-threshold showers, and roll-in showers to suit different needs and preferences.

Are there specific features to consider for a disability shower? Features such as grab bars, non-slip flooring, seating, and handheld showerheads can enhance safety and usability.
